What is binomial distribution?The number of successes in a defined number of independent trials with two possible outcomes (success or failure) and a constant probability of success are described by a discrete probability distribution called a binomial distribution. The number of trials (n) and the likelihood that a trial will succeed (p) serve as the two parameters that define the binomial distribution.
a. The total quantity of employed women among the sample of 7 who are not married yet is the random variable X of interest in this situation.
b) The probability of 2 women who have never been married is:
P(X = 2) = (7 choose 2) * (0.2)² * (0.8)⁵
P(X = 2) = 21 * 0.04 * 0.32768
P(X = 2) = 0.2749
c) For 2 or fewer have never been married:
P(X ≤ 2) = P(X = 0) + P(X = 1) + P(X = 2)
P(X ≤ 2) = (7 choose 0) * (0.2)⁰ * (0.8)⁷ + (7 choose 1) * (0.2)¹ * (0.8)⁶ + (7 choose 2) * (0.2)² * (0.8)⁵
P(X ≤ 2) = 0.0577 + 0.2013 + 0.2749
P(X ≤ 2) = 0.5339
d) The mean is given as:
μ = np
Substitute n = 7 and p = 0.2:
7 * 0.2 = 1.4
Now, the standard deviation is given as:
σ = √(np(1-p)) = √(7 * 0.2 * 0.8) = 1.0198

What is equation of circle?
Every point in a plane that is at a certain distance from the center point forms a circle. In order to go around a curve while maintaining a constant distance from another point, a moving point in a plane must follow a specific path.
The following is the typical form for expressing the equation of a circle:
[tex](x-h)^{2} + (y-k)^2 = r^2[/tex]
Here,
(h, k) represents the center and r is the radius.
We are given that the center is (-3, 4) and the radius is 7.
Now, using the standard form, we get
⇒ [tex](x-(-3))^{2} + (y-4)^2 = 7^2[/tex]
⇒ [tex](x+3)^{2} + (y-4)^2[/tex] = 49
Hence, the equation of circle in the standard with given center and radius is [tex](x+3)^{2} + (y-4)^2[/tex] = 49.

Dorothy Wagner is currently selling 40 "I ♥ Calculus" T-shirts per day, but sales are dropping at a rate of 4 per day. She is currently charging $7 per T-shirt, but to compensate for dwindling sales, she is increasing the unit price by $1 per day. How fast, and in what direction, is her daily revenue currently changing?
The rate at which her daily revenue is currently changing and the direction of the change is; Her revenue is currently increasing at $12 per day
What is the rate of change of a function?The rate of change of a function is the rate at which the output of the function changes per unit change in the input of the function.
Let x represent the number of days, therefore;
The number of T-shirts Dorothy sells, y = 40 - 4·x
The price at which she sells the T-shirts = 7 + x
Therefore, Dorothy's daily revenue, R(x) = (40 - 4·x) × (7 + x) = 12·x - 4·x² + 280
The rate of change of her daily revenue can be obtained from the derivative of the revenue function as follows;
The rate at which her daily revenue is therefore;
R'(x) = d(R(x))/dx = 12 - 8·x
The rate at which her revenue is changing currently can be obtained from the rate function by plugging in x = 0, as follows;
R'(0) = 12 - 8×0 = 12
Her revenue is changing at a rate of $+12 per day.
The positive value of the rate, 12, indicates that her revenue is increasing at $12 per day

PLEASE HELP! An ethanol railroad tariff is a fee charged for shipments of ethanol on public railroads. An agricultural association publishes tariff rates for railroad-car shipments of ethanol. Assuming that the standard deviation of such tariff rates is $1200, determine the probability that the mean tariff rate of 400 randomly selected railroad-car shipments of ethanol will be within $80 of the mean tariff rate of all railroad-car shipments of ethanol. Interpret your answer in terms of sampling error. The probability is what?
(Round to three decimal places as needed.) Thanks!
If an ethanol railroad tariff is a fee charged for shipments of ethanol on public railroads. The probability is: 84.6%.
How to find the probability?In this case, we have:
Population standard deviation (σ): $1200
Sample size (n): 400
Margin of error (E): $80
The standard deviation of the sample mean can be calculated as:
σM = σ / √n = 1200 / √400 = 60
To find the probability that the sample mean is within $80 of the population mean, we need to find the z-scores for the upper and lower limits of the interval:
Lower limit: z = (mean - E - population mean) / σM = (-80) / 60 = -1.3333
Upper limit: z = (mean + E - population mean) / σM = 80 / 60 = 1.3333
Using a standard normal distribution table or calculator, we can find the area under the curve between these two z-scores:
P(-1.3333 < Z < 1.3333) = 0.8461
Therefore, the probability that the mean tariff rate of 400 randomly selected railroad-car shipments of ethanol will be within $80 of the mean tariff rate of all railroad-car shipments of ethanol is approximately 0.846 or 84.6%.
Interpretation: This means that if we take many samples of 400 railroad-car shipments of ethanol and calculate their mean tariff rates, about 84.6% of these means will be within $80 of the true mean tariff rate of all ethanol shipments. This also means that there is a sampling error of $80, which is the maximum amount by which the sample mean may differ from the population mean due to random sampling variability.

What is the slope intercept of -2 and y-intercept (0,2)?
Answer:
The slope-intercept form of the equation of a line is:
y = mx + b
where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ept.
We are given that the y-intercept is (0,2), which means that the value of b is 2.
We are also given that the slope is -2, which means that the value of m is -2.
Substituting these values into the slope-intercept form, we get:
y = -2x + 2
Therefore, the slope-intercept form of the equation of the line is y = -2x + 2.
